What affects the price

Remodeling costs vary based on what you choose. If you are just swapping out a shower or tub, you will spend significantly less than a full gut-and-replace project. Things like luxury fixtures, custom tile patterns, and moving plumbing lines behind the walls will shift the total higher. On the other hand, choosing standard finishes and keeping your existing layout helps keep your budget manageable. Every home is different, and ex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

What type of satin paint is best for a bathroom?

For bathrooms in Jackson, a high-quality satin or eggshell finish paint is recommended due to its durability and moisture resistance. These finishes are washable, allowing for easy cleaning of water spots and minor smudges. Look for paints specifically formulated for bathrooms, which often contain mildew inhibitors to combat humidity. The paint should be applied over a properly primed surface for optimal adhesion and longevity. A satin finish provides a subtle sheen without being overly glossy.

What are the best wood bathroom vanities?

The best wood bathroom vanities are constructed from solid hardwoods like oak, maple, or cherry, known for their durability and resistance to moisture when properly sealed. Engineered wood or plywood with a high-quality veneer can also be a good option, offering stability and moisture resistance. Look for vanities with a durable finish that protects against water and stains. Consider the construction quality, including drawer glides and joinery, for long-term performance. What are the most durable bathroom floor tiles?

The most durable bathroom floor tiles are generally porcelain and ceramic tiles, particularly those with a high PEI rating (3 or higher) indicating good resistance to wear. Porcelain tiles are exceptionally dense and have very low water absorption, making them highly resistant to staining and moisture damage. For safety in wet areas, a matte or textured finish is recommended to enhance slip resistance. The pros can help you select tiles that balance durability with your aesthetic preferences.
